What are the opposite words for give a big hand?
Antonyms for "give a big hand" include "ignore," "condemn," "rebuke," "disapprove," and "criticize." These words reflect a lack of positive acknowledgment or appreciation for someone's efforts, achievements, or contributions. Ignoring or condemning someone can have a negative impact on their self-confidence and motivation, and can discourage them from continuing to work hard or make meaningful contributions.
